Arrow: New Collision Course Images Reveal Why The Fractured Team Is Fighting

In recent memory, you may have noticed that The CW has been dropping images taken from episodes of their various series well before they actually air. To be honest, this practice is commonplace, but I can't help but think of how many times the more recent examples have fueled speculation or flat-out spoiled what's to come.

If you’ll recall, the first photos promoting “Collision Course” dropped about a week ago, right before its preceding episode, “The Devil’s Greatest Trick,” had even aired. In those, we saw the original Team Arrow seemingly hiding out in a cabin for some undefined reason, prompting me to think that a second batch of images would soon follow.

Well, it turns out that I was actually right, for the network has now declassified five additional pictures (seen below) revealing that Quentin Lance and the original Team Arrow are harboring Black Siren, thus explaining why they’re about to throw down with Team Arrow 2.0.

Before, we just thought this donnybrook seemed like a way for both sides to blow steam before all arrive on the same page, but now it all makes perfect sense. With Black Siren recently having killed Black Canary’s lover, Vigilante, her gang will have all the more reason to want to use excessive force on anyone who gets in their way.

For more, be sure to check out the official synopsis:

OTA VS. NTA — Oliver (Stephen Amell), Diggle (David Ramsey) and Felicity (Emily Bett Rickards) disagree with Dinah (Juliana Harkavy), Curtis (Echo Kellum) and Rene (Rick Gonzalez) on how to handle Black Siren (Katie Cassidy). The two teams face off and a fight ensues. Ken Shane directed the episode written by Oscar Balderrama & Rebecca Bellotto (#614).

Arrow returns with new episodes on Thursday, March 1st on The CW.
